Hi Lucy

I know you want a definitive answer, but it is impossible for anyone to give you one.

If claimants have to inform the DWP they have been away for more than four weeks, they may get asked about their holiday at their next review - but they may not. If they are asked, no one can know beforehand whether going on holiday will have a negative impact on their next award, because it will depend on whether there have been any changes in their condition, what answers they give, what evidence they have submitted and the opinion of the health professional. It's entirely possible that their award is decreased and it has nothing to do with the holiday.

If you go for more than four weeks and you have to inform them - they don't suddenly take your PIP away.
